Mediocrity Quotes

Mediocre men often have the most acquired knowledge. Claude Bernard

In the republic of mediocrity genius is dangerous. Robert G Ingersoll

Only mediocrity can be trusted to be always at its best. Max Beerbohm

People who are unable to motivate themselves must be content with mediocrity, no matter how impressive their other talents. Andrew Carnegie

When small men attempt great enterprises, they always end by reducing them to the level of their mediocrity.’ Napoleon Bonaparte

Most of our pocket wisdom is conceived for the use of mediocre people, to discourage them from ambitious attempts, and generally console them in their mediocrity. Robert Louis Stevenson

Women want mediocre men, and men are working to become as mediocre as possible. Margaret Mead

There is always a heavy demand for fresh mediocrity. In every generation the least cultivated taste has the largest appetite. Paul Gauguin
